Development and psychometric validation of the Food Safety Practice Scale (FSPS-18) for the adult population in Bangladesh: insights from the classical test theory and gender invariance test in a cross-sectional study

Background Food safety practices contribute as a primary factor to foodborne diseases and deaths, though there is no validated known psychometric properties scale accessible for consistent measurement.Aim The current study aims to develop and validate the psychometric properties of the multifactorial Food Safety Practice Scale.Method We adhered to the guidelines of Boateng et al for scale development. We developed a structured questionnaire using a deductive approach based on the WHO’s Five Keys to Safer Food’s domains, checked content validity, pre-tested and included 1652 responses (mean age: 30.79 years) using convenience sampling in a cross-sectional study. Descriptive statistics were calculated. Next, the dataset was split into two independent subsets. Item reduction and factor extraction were conducted on the Exploratory Factor Analysis (EFA) subset, while the scale’s dimensionality, reliability and validity were tested on the Confirmatory Factor Analysis (CFA) subset.Result The final scale, FSPS-18, comprised 18 items, refined from an initial pool of 31 items, grouped into four highly correlated constructs, with inter-construct correlations ranging from 0.68 to 0.83. Factor loadings were substantial in both EFA and CFA (0.536 to 0.929). The scale demonstrated robust reliability in both datasets (Cronbach’s alpha ≈ 0.93). CFA indices indicated excellent model fit. Additionally, the invariance test, convergent, discriminant and concurrent validity were well demonstrated. Although we rooted our conceptual framework in WHO’s domains, our scale demonstrated four factors that are different from the concept. However, FSPS-18 factors are easily interpretable using the Theory of Planned Behavior model and Health Belief Model.Conclusion The FSPS-18 has proven to be a reliable and valid scale, contributing to the standardisation of measuring food safety practices.
